To make or become less strong or powerful. The long illness had weakened him considerably.
To reduce the intensity or effectiveness of something. The new evidence weakened the prosecution's case.
To diminish the physical strength or energy of someone or something. The harsh weather conditions weakened the structure of the bridge.
To cause a decrease in the value or quality of something. The economic crisis weakened the currency significantly.
To become less resolute or determined; to give way. Her resolve weakened and she finally agreed to the proposal.
